Colmex vs Core Spreads - Headquarters And Year Of Founding
Colmex was founded in 1990 and has its head office in Cyprus.
Core Spreads was founded in 2014 and has its head office in London.

However, this doesn't necessarily mean that online brokers don't charge any fees. They charge prices of varying rates for a variety of services to earn money. There are mainly three types of fees for this purpose.
The first kind of charges to look out for are trading fees. When you make an actual trade, like purchasing a stock or an ETF, you're billed trading charges. In such instances, you're spending a spread, financing rate, or a commission. The sorts of trading charges and the prices differ from broker to broker.
Commissions could be fixed or dependent on the traded volume. On the other hand, a spread refers to the difference between the buying and selling price. Financing or overnight prices are those that are billed when you maintain a leveraged position for longer than daily.
Aside from trading fees, online agents also charge non-trading fees. These are dependent on the actions you undertake in your accounts. They're charged for operations like depositing money, not trading for long periods, or withdrawals.
